温馨提示×

Ubuntu如何安装Fortran IDE

小樊
45
2025-10-24 20:20:40
栏目: 智能运维

Ubuntu安装Fortran IDE的步骤

1. 安装Fortran编译器(基础准备)

在安装IDE前,需先安装Fortran编译器(如GFortran),这是IDE正常运行的核心依赖。打开终端,依次执行以下命令:

sudo apt update  # 更新系统包列表
sudo apt install gfortran  # 安装GFortran编译器
gfortran --version  # 验证安装(显示版本信息则成功)

若需要特定版本(如gfortran-7),可通过sudo apt install gfortran-7安装,再用sudo update-alternatives --config gfortran切换默认版本。

2. 安装常用Fortran IDE

选项1:Visual Studio Code(轻量灵活,推荐新手)

  • 安装VSCode:通过终端执行sudo snap install --classic code(Snap方式)或从官网下载.deb包,再用sudo dpkg -i package_name.deb安装。
  • 配置Fortran插件
    • 打开VSCode,点击左侧扩展图标(或按Ctrl+Shift+X);
    • 搜索“Fortran”并安装以下插件:
      • Modern Fortran(代码高亮、智能提示);
      • hansec.fortran-ls(Fortran语言服务器,提升代码分析能力);
      • krvajalm.linter-gfortran(GFortran lint工具,检查代码错误)。
  • 验证配置:创建hello.f90文件(内容见下文),按F5编译运行,若终端输出“Hello, World!”则配置成功。

选项2:Eclipse with Eclipse Fortran(功能全面,适合大型项目)

  • 安装Eclipse:从Eclipse官网下载“Eclipse IDE for C/C++ Developers”版本(支持Fortran插件)。
  • 安装Fortran插件
    • 打开Eclipse,点击顶部菜单栏“Help”→“Eclipse Marketplace”;
    • 搜索“Eclipse Fortran”并点击“Install”,跟随向导完成安装;
    • 重启Eclipse使插件生效。
  • 创建Fortran项目:选择“File”→“New”→“Project”,搜索“Fortran Project”并创建,即可开始编写代码。

选项3:Code::Blocks(开源免费,适合传统桌面开发)

  • 添加Code::Blocks PPA:打开终端,执行sudo add-apt-repository ppa:codeblocks-devs/release(添加官方PPA以获取最新版本);
  • 安装Code::Blocks:执行sudo apt update更新包列表,再执行sudo apt install codeblocks codeblocks-contrib(安装Code::Blocks及扩展插件);
  • 启动IDE:从系统应用程序菜单中找到“Code::Blocks”,打开后选择“File”→“New”→“Fortran Project”创建项目。

3. 验证IDE功能(通用测试)

无论选择哪种IDE,均可通过以下简单Fortran程序验证配置是否成功:

program hello
  implicit none
  print *, 'Hello, World!'  ! 输出Hello World
end program hello
  • 将代码保存为hello.f90
  • 在IDE中点击“Run”或按对应快捷键(如VSCode的F5),生成可执行文件并运行;
  • 若终端输出“Hello, World!”,则说明IDE与Fortran编译器集成成功。

注意事项

  • 若需更强大的调试功能,可在VSCode中安装“C/C++”插件(ms-vscode.cpptools),支持Fortran断点调试;
  • 对于Intel Fortran Compiler用户,需先安装Intel oneAPI工具包,并通过source /opt/intel/oneapi/setvars.sh配置环境变量,再在IDE中指定编译器路径。

0